您的位置:首页 > 教育 > 培训 > 企业信用信息查询公示系统山东_建立网站教学的_快速排名提升_seo关键词快速排名前三位

企业信用信息查询公示系统山东_建立网站教学的_快速排名提升_seo关键词快速排名前三位

2024/12/21 18:48:11 来源:https://blog.csdn.net/qq_37703224/article/details/144602644  浏览:    关键词:企业信用信息查询公示系统山东_建立网站教学的_快速排名提升_seo关键词快速排名前三位
企业信用信息查询公示系统山东_建立网站教学的_快速排名提升_seo关键词快速排名前三位

什么是组件化开发

组件化开发是一种软件设计方法,它将大型软件系统分解成更小、更易于管理的部分,这些部分被称为组件。每个组件封装了特定的功能和界面,并且可以独立于系统的其他部分进行开发和测试。这种方法使得开发过程更加模块化,有助于提高代码的可重用性和可维护性。

在Vue中进行组件化开发,首先需要理解Vue的组件系统。Vue组件是一个包含模板、逻辑和样式的独立单元。通过创建组件,可以将复杂的界面分解成更小的、可管理的部分。Vue组件的基本结构包括三个部分: <template> 定义了组件的HTML结构,<script> 包含了组件的逻辑,<style> 定义了组件的样式。开发者可以通过Vue.component方法或单文件组件(.vue文件)来定义组件。

使用Vue进行组件化开发时,可以利用其提供的props、事件、插槽和混入等功能来实现组件间的通信和功能复用。Props允许父组件向子组件传递数据,事件允许子组件向父组件发送消息,插槽使得组件布局更加灵活,混入则可以复用跨组件的逻辑。通过这些机制,开发者可以构建出高度可复用和可维护的组件库。

组件化开发的优势在于它提高了开发效率和代码质量。由于组件是独立的,开发者可以并行开发和测试不同的组件,这有助于加快开发进程。同时,每个组件的职责明确,使得代码更加清晰和易于理解。组件化还有助于团队协作,不同的开发者可以专注于不同的组件,减少了代码冲突的可能性。

此外,组件化开发还提高了代码的可测试性。由于组件是独立的,可以单独对每个组件进行测试,这有助于及时发现和修复问题。组件化还使得代码更容易维护和扩展,因为每个组件都是独立的,修改一个组件不会影响到其他组件,这使得后期的维护和功能扩展变得更加容易。

总的来说,组件化开发是一种有效的软件开发方法,它通过将系统分解成独立的组件来提高开发效率、代码质量和可维护性。Vue.js作为一个现代化的前端框架,提供了强大的组件系统,使得开发者可以轻松地实现组件化开发,构建出高效、可维护的前端应用。

如何进行组件化开发

作为新手进行组件化开发,你可以从理解组件的基本概念开始。在Vue中,组件是自定义的标签,用于封装可复用的代码。每个组件都有自己的视图(模板)和逻辑(脚本),可以包含HTML、CSS和JavaScript。

首先,创建一个简单的组件来熟悉基本流程。例如,你可以创建一个“欢迎组件”,它显示一个欢迎信息。在Vue项目中,你可以使用单文件组件(.vue文件)来定义这个组件。文件结构如下:

<template><div><h1>{{ message }}</h1></div>
</template><script>
export default {data() {return {message: '欢迎来到组件化开发!'};}
}
</script><style scoped>
h1 {color: b

版权声明:

本网仅为发布的内容提供存储空间,不对发表、转载的内容提供任何形式的保证。凡本网注明“来源:XXX网络”的作品,均转载自其它媒体,著作权归作者所有,商业转载请联系作者获得授权,非商业转载请注明出处。

我们尊重并感谢每一位作者,均已注明文章来源和作者。如因作品内容、版权或其它问题,请及时与我们联系,联系邮箱:809451989@qq.com,投稿邮箱:809451989@qq.com